// Sharding constant for the Fennel profile store. We split user
// profiles across 64 logical shards, hashed on account handle, not
// numeric ID — yes, that's weird, but the old Quillbrook migration
// left numeric IDs non-uniform and handles actually balance better.
// If you bump this number you MUST run the reshard job first, or
// half the lookups will miss. Ask the storage crew before touching
// anything here. The build token this constant was last verified
// against is noted below.

session token of tajef-bageg = htk21_5d90d574934f3ccae6437

Ticket #MD-412: Markdown pipeline tweak

Hey folks — we're swapping the Brindlewood renderer's footnote plugin for the new inline parser. Preview builds look good, but tables with nested code blocks need a second pass before we ship. New joiners: don't merge rendering changes without a green snapshot suite. This one still needs sign-off from the person named below.

approver of yahif-hahif = Wenwyn Eliael

For this week's eng sync: the MemLens GPU profiling toolkit is now the standard for tracking allocation spikes on the Corvid training cluster. New engineers should install the agent, run the sample capture against the toy model, and review the flame-graph output before attempting live profiling. Capture archives are encrypted at rest; if you need to restore an archive on a fresh workstation, the decryption flow asks for the team recovery passphrase. The current passphrase is:

vault phrase of tajef-tafog = istox-sorax-zorox-casok-holox-kelix-weneth-drueth-casion

## Ledgerline Environments — Partitioning

All three environments now partition the events table by month, rolling partitions created two months ahead. Staging mirrors production's retention; dev keeps only the current month. Detach-and-archive jobs run on the first Sunday. For the sync: behavior differs per environment, so check settings before comparing query plans. Current values per environment are:

service settings:
PRAIX_LOG_LEVEL=error
PRAIX_METRICS_HOST=metrics.praix.qorvelcorp.corp
PRAIX_POOL_SIZE=16